Overview
The Glow Breathable Blemish Balm BB Cream 1oz sits in an interesting middle ground — not quite a traditional BB cream, not quite a tinted moisturizer, but something that borrows thoughtfully from both. Its standout ingredient is green tea leaf water, which forms the formula's base and delivers genuine antioxidant hydration rather than just surface-level moisture. At 1 fl oz, it's priced above drugstore staples but below prestige brands, occupying a mid-range position. Coverage is honestly light — this is about evening out skin tone and adding a healthy glow, not concealing blemishes. For acne-prone or sensitive skin types, the non-comedogenic claim is a meaningful selling point worth taking seriously.
Features & Benefits
The green tea water base does more than read well on a label — green tea is a studied antioxidant that helps buffer skin against environmental stress while sustaining hydration without the heavy, film-like feeling some formulas carry. The tone correction is intentionally subtle: this tinted moisturizer softens uneven patches without flattening natural skin texture, so the finish looks lived-in rather than painted on. It's non-comedogenic, designed to sit on skin without congesting pores during wear. A practical bonus is its use as a foundation mixer — blending it into a heavier base effectively sheers out coverage, which stretches the product's versatility well beyond a single role.

User Feedback
Sitting at 4.4 out of 5 stars, the Glow blemish balm has earned mostly warm responses, with buyers frequently praising how weightless it feels throughout the day and how naturally it blends into skin. Those with drier complexions seem especially pleased with the hydrating payoff. The criticisms that surface consistently are worth flagging, though. Shade range is the most common sticking point — one option simply excludes a wide range of skin tones, and that's a real gap regardless of how well the formula performs. A secondary complaint is unmet coverage expectations; buyers hoping to mask redness or spots often find the sheer finish isn't quite enough.

Not suitable for:
The Glow Breathable Blemish Balm BB Cream 1oz has a meaningful limitation that no amount of good formulation can fix: it currently comes in a single shade skewing toward fair to light-medium, neutral-undertone complexions, which outright excludes a large portion of potential buyers. Anyone with medium-deep, deep, or strongly warm or cool undertones will likely find the shade either too light or too ashy to blend convincingly. Beyond shade range, this is also not the right pick for anyone seeking real coverage — if hiding redness, hyperpigmentation, or active breakouts is the priority, this tinted moisturizer simply does not have the pigment load to do that job. People who prefer a matte finish or need long, heavy-wear performance — such as for events, humid climates, or oily skin that tends to break through light formulas — will find themselves disappointed. At its price point, the single-shade constraint is a harder pill to swallow than it might be for a budget alternative.
Specifications
- Brand: Manufactured and sold under the Glow brand.
- Volume: Each unit contains 1 fl oz (approximately 30 ml) of product.
- Dimensions: The packaging measures 2 x 2 x 4 inches (L x W x H).
- Weight: The packaged unit weighs 5.29 ounces including the container.
- Coverage Level: Provides light, sheer-to-light coverage suited for tone evening rather than concealment.
- Finish Type: Delivers a radiant, luminous finish designed to mimic healthy, natural-looking skin.
- Key Ingredient: Formulated with a green tea leaf water base, which provides antioxidant properties and lasting hydration.
- Formula Texture: Lightweight and moisture-rich, designed to feel breathable and non-heavy throughout the day.
- Skin Type: Marketed as suitable for all skin types, with particular benefit for dry, combination, and dehydrated skin.
- Non-Comedogenic: The formula is non-comedogenic, meaning it is developed to avoid blocking or congesting pores during wear.
- Shade Range: Currently available in a single shade described as white or neutral sheer tone, best suited to fair to light-medium complexions.
- Age Range: Intended for adult use only.
- Primary Use: Can be applied as a standalone tinted moisturizer or blended with a heavier foundation to reduce its coverage.
- SPF Content: No SPF value is listed for this product; a separate sunscreen is recommended for daytime use.
